Cultural beliefs (and misbeliefs) likewise contribute to missed out on autism medical diagnoses. Numerous ladies are anticipated to behave in quieter and much less assertive ways than boys. A woman that seems timid and withdrawn might be viewed as "feminine," while a child with the same qualities would certainly obtain treatment due to the fact that they are not showing more external "young boy" behavior.

Autism Range Disorder (ASD) is usually misdiagnosed amongst women due to its historic association with men. This gender bias creates a substantial sex space, leaving roughly 80% of females with undiagnosed or misdiagnosed ASD approximately the age of 18, making prompt treatment almost difficult. This under-diagnosis results in major repercussions on women's mental health as they commonly get dealt with for the incorrect disorders like clinical depression or anxiousness. Gendered distinctions in autism spectrum disorder are more probable to be neglected when they're extra subtle.
